Cant: Thank you for your interest in the South Carolina State Guard. You have taken the first step toward becoming a member of one of our State’s oldest military organizations. The State Guard is a part of the South Carolina Military Department and there are a number of qualifications that all new personnel must meet. Some of these requirements are as follows: □ Be between the ages of seventeen (17) years (with parent/guardian consent) and 71 years of age. □ A US citizen or a resident of S.

Yes, the South Carolina State Guard (SC SCSG 20-66) is a military organization. Specifically, it is a component of the South Carolina Military Department, alongside the South Carolina Army National Guard and the South Carolina Air National Guard. Its primary mission is to assist the state's governance and provide support during emergencies. This means that while it may not operate like active duty forces, it plays a crucial role in the state's military framework.

Since its inception in 1670, members of the SC State Guard have volunteered their time and skills without pay.

There are seven distinct levels in noncommissioned officer service, including Sergeant, Staff Sergeant, Sergeant First Class, Master Sergeant, First Sergeant, Sergeant Major, and Command Sergeant Major. In addition, there is the position of Sergeant Major of the State Guard.
